LED Machine Vision Lighting Market Overview
The global LED Machine Vision Lighting Market is forecast to expand from USD 467.43 million in 2026 to USD 506.23 million in 2027, and is expected to reach USD 963.87 million by 2035, growing at a CAGR of 8.3% over the forecast period.
The global LED Machine Vision Lighting Market is expanding rapidly, driven by the increasing adoption of automated inspection systems across manufacturing sectors. Over 78% of industrial inspection systems worldwide utilize LED-based lighting for high precision image capturing. With over 12,000 machine vision installations recorded globally in 2024, LED lighting systems are becoming the backbone of industrial automation. More than 65% of new smart factories rely on machine vision lighting solutions for quality assurance and surface inspection. The growing demand for precision, color accuracy, and uniform brightness in manufacturing lines continues to drive innovation within the LED Machine Vision Lighting Market.

LED Machine Vision Lighting Market Dynamics
DRIVER
"Rising demand for automated quality inspection in manufacturing"
The increasing implementation of automation and robotics in manufacturing lines is a primary driver of the LED Machine Vision Lighting Market. Approximately 76% of manufacturers have integrated automated visual inspection systems using LED lighting to reduce human error and improve production accuracy. The transition from manual inspection to machine-based systems has resulted in 35% shorter inspection cycles and 29% higher defect detection rates. As LED lighting offers stable illumination, low heat generation, and high durability (over 50,000 operational hours), industries prefer it for continuous operation. The rise of Industry 4.0, along with a 45% increase in smart factory projects since 2022, continues to strengthen LED lighting demand in machine vision applications.
RESTRAINT
"High installation and calibration costs"
While LED machine vision lighting delivers operational precision, 48% of small-scale manufacturers cite high setup costs as a restraint. The integration of LED systems with cameras, lenses, and sensors often requires precision calibration, adding up to 12–15% to the total equipment cost. Additionally, 26% of manufacturers face challenges in retrofitting older inspection systems with LED lighting, limiting adoption. The cost of optical filters, light controllers, and cabling also contributes to capital expenses. As a result, cost-conscious industries in developing regions are slower to adopt advanced LED lighting systems despite their long-term benefits.
OPPORTUNITY
"Expansion in AI-integrated and hyperspectral imaging solutions"
The integration of AI and hyperspectral imaging with LED machine vision lighting systems presents major growth opportunities. Approximately 58% of new installations in 2024 incorporated AI-assisted illumination control to dynamically adjust light intensity and wavelength. Hyperspectral LED modules, capable of operating across 350–1000 nm, are being adopted for food, semiconductor, and medical inspection processes. The increasing use of automated vision systems in pharmaceuticals, where inspection accuracy must exceed 99.5%, has accelerated AI-driven LED innovation. The growing trend of predictive quality control and automated failure detection creates a pathway for new AI-integrated LED lighting products across multiple industries.
CHALLENGE
"Managing heat dissipation and power efficiency"
Thermal management remains a key technical challenge in the LED Machine Vision Lighting Market. Over 37% of manufacturers report operational issues due to heat accumulation in high-intensity LED systems. Excessive heat affects illumination uniformity and shortens LED lifespan. Cooling mechanisms, such as air or liquid cooling modules, increase system complexity and cost. To overcome this, manufacturers are developing high-efficiency LED arrays with 18–25% improved thermal resistance. Maintaining consistent brightness levels across inspection cycles remains difficult, especially in high-speed imaging systems that demand constant illumination. Addressing these thermal and efficiency challenges is essential for long-term performance and stability.
LED Machine Vision Lighting Market Segmentation
By Type
Ring Light Source: Ring light sources hold 32% of the total market due to their uniform 360° illumination, reducing shadow effects. They are widely used in electronic and PCB inspection, where even light distribution is crucial for edge detection. Over 40,000 ring light systems were deployed globally in 2024, highlighting their role in machine vision. Their small footprint and adjustable diameter options have increased usage in robotic arms and conveyor inspection setups.
Bar Light Source: Bar lights represent 24% of market installations, ideal for inspecting large or flat surfaces. Commonly applied in packaging and printing industries, these lights deliver linear illumination across inspection areas. The introduction of high-brightness LED bars with intensity above 25,000 lux has boosted accuracy in surface analysis. Modular bar systems are preferred for conveyor line scanning and machine vision integration due to their scalability and compact design.
Back Lights: Backlights account for 18% of the market and are critical for silhouette imaging and shape detection. In 2024, over 22,000 backlight systems were installed in quality inspection lines. They are used extensively in dimensional measurement, edge profiling, and defect detection of transparent materials. Backlight panels with LED densities exceeding 350 LEDs/m² have improved imaging contrast, enabling precise geometric analysis in manufacturing lines.
Coaxial Light Source: Coaxial lighting systems comprise 16% of the LED machine vision lighting market. They are primarily used in reflective surface inspection for semiconductors and metallic parts. Coaxial modules using beam splitters achieve over 90% reflection efficiency, providing even illumination on glossy surfaces. More than 18,000 coaxial units were utilized in electronics inspection in 2024, highlighting their relevance in precision industries.
Others: The remaining 10% of the market consists of dome lights, diffuse lights, and line lights. These specialized LED systems are designed for niche applications such as label inspection, food packaging, and medical imaging. Dome lights, used for curved object inspection, have seen a 21% increase in adoption since 2023. The customization of LED lighting geometries continues to drive innovation across specialized industries.
By Application
Electronics Industry: The electronics industry accounts for 33% of total LED machine vision lighting utilization, driven by inspection of PCBs, connectors, and microchips. More than 70% of PCB manufacturers rely on LED ring and bar lighting for automated optical inspection. High-resolution vision systems supported by LED illumination have improved defect detection accuracy by 28%, reducing rework rates and improving output quality.
Display Industry: In the display industry, LED lighting systems represent 19% of market applications. Used for glass and screen inspection, these lighting modules ensure surface uniformity and defect-free panel production. More than 15,000 installations in 2024 supported OLED and LCD inspection lines. With precision requirements below 5 microns, LED backlights and coaxial lights play a crucial role in maintaining display quality.
Logistics Industry: The logistics sector contributes 14% of global LED machine vision lighting adoption. Used in barcode reading, packaging verification, and labeling, these systems enhance automation efficiency. LED lights enable 99.9% scanning accuracy in high-speed sorting lines. Warehouses across North America and Europe have increased deployment by 27% since 2022, improving real-time tracking and shipment validation.
Semiconductor Industry: The semiconductor industry accounts for 22% of the LED machine vision lighting market. Coaxial and backlight sources are crucial for wafer alignment, die inspection, and pattern recognition. More than 11,500 installations were recorded in 2024, emphasizing precision-driven applications. The adoption of infrared LEDs and multi-spectrum sources has improved yield inspection accuracy by 33%.
Others: The remaining 12% includes automotive, food & beverage, and pharmaceutical sectors. Automotive factories use LED vision lights for surface and welding inspection, with over 9,000 installations in 2024. Food inspection facilities employ LED systems for contamination detection, improving accuracy by 21%. Pharmaceutical packaging lines use high-lumen LED lighting for serial code verification and defect detection.

New Product Development
From 2023 to 2025, LED machine vision lighting manufacturers have launched numerous innovations. More than 27 new models introduced during this period feature programmable light control and multispectral imaging. Companies like OMRON and Smart Vision Lights have developed adaptive LED systems that automatically adjust wavelength and brightness in response to object characteristics. High-power LED arrays now offer illumination exceeding 35,000 lux, improving detection accuracy for complex materials. Additionally, modular lighting platforms compatible with Industry 4.0 systems have increased production flexibility by 29%. Miniaturized LED designs for compact cameras are gaining momentum, with product dimensions reduced by 22% compared to 2022. There is also a trend toward integrating thermal management modules to extend operational life beyond 60,000 hours, improving reliability in high-speed industrial environments.
Five Recent Developments (2023–2025)
- CCS Lighting (2024): Launched an AI-controlled color temperature adjustment system improving inspection contrast by 33%.
- Smart Vision Lights (2025): Introduced a high-lumen modular bar light system for conveyor inspection with 28% higher efficiency.
- OMRON (2024): Deployed an adaptive lighting algorithm improving defect detection rates by 21%.
- ProPhotonix (2023): Expanded its infrared LED line to cover wavelengths up to 1550 nm, enabling deep surface imaging.
- EFFILUX (2025): Released a water-resistant dome light system with IP67 certification, enhancing use in harsh environments.
